New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 7910 for branches/2017/dev_r7881_no_wrk_alloc/NEMOGCM/NEMO/LIM_SRC_3/limistate.F90 – NEMO

Ignore:
Timestamp:
2017-04-13T16:21:08+02:00 (7 years ago)
Author:
timgraham
Message:

All wrk_alloc removed

File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/2017/dev_r7881_no_wrk_alloc/NEMOGCM/NEMO/LIM_SRC_3/limistate.F90

    r7761 r7910  
    2828   USE lib_mpp          ! MPP library 
    2929   USE lib_fortran      ! Fortran utilities (allows no signed zero when 'key_nosignedzero' defined)   
    30    USE wrk_nemo         ! work arrays 
    3130   USE fldread          ! read input fields 
    3231   USE iom 
     
    8281      INTEGER  :: i_hemis, i_fill, jl0   
    8382      REAL(wp)   :: zarg, zV, zconv, zdv  
    84       REAL(wp), POINTER, DIMENSION(:,:)   :: zswitch    ! ice indicator 
    85       REAL(wp), POINTER, DIMENSION(:,:)   :: zht_i_ini, zat_i_ini, zvt_i_ini            !data from namelist or nc file 
    86       REAL(wp), POINTER, DIMENSION(:,:)   :: zts_u_ini, zht_s_ini, zsm_i_ini, ztm_i_ini !data from namelist or nc file 
    87       REAL(wp), POINTER, DIMENSION(:,:,:) :: zh_i_ini, za_i_ini                         !data by cattegories to fill 
    88       INTEGER , POINTER, DIMENSION(:)     :: itest 
    89       !-------------------------------------------------------------------- 
    90  
    91       CALL wrk_alloc( jpi, jpj, jpl, zh_i_ini,  za_i_ini ) 
    92       CALL wrk_alloc( jpi, jpj,      zht_i_ini, zat_i_ini, zvt_i_ini, zts_u_ini, zht_s_ini, zsm_i_ini, ztm_i_ini ) 
    93       CALL wrk_alloc( jpi, jpj,      zswitch ) 
    94       Call wrk_alloc( 4,             itest ) 
     83      REAL(wp), DIMENSION(jpi,jpj)   :: zswitch    ! ice indicator 
     84      REAL(wp), DIMENSION(jpi,jpj)   :: zht_i_ini, zat_i_ini, zvt_i_ini            !data from namelist or nc file 
     85      REAL(wp), DIMENSION(jpi,jpj)   :: zts_u_ini, zht_s_ini, zsm_i_ini, ztm_i_ini !data from namelist or nc file 
     86      REAL(wp), DIMENSION(jpi,jpj,jpl) :: zh_i_ini, za_i_ini                         !data by cattegories to fill 
     87      INTEGER , DIMENSION(4)     :: itest 
     88      !-------------------------------------------------------------------- 
    9589 
    9690      IF(lwp) WRITE(numout,*) 
     
    464458!!!       
    465459 
    466       CALL wrk_dealloc( jpi, jpj, jpl, zh_i_ini,  za_i_ini ) 
    467       CALL wrk_dealloc( jpi, jpj,      zht_i_ini, zat_i_ini, zvt_i_ini, zts_u_ini, zht_s_ini, zsm_i_ini, ztm_i_ini ) 
    468       CALL wrk_dealloc( jpi, jpj,      zswitch ) 
    469460      Call wrk_dealloc( 4,             itest ) 
    470461 
Note: See TracChangeset for help on using the changeset viewer.